Community safety

As an authority, we are committed to looking at the crime reduction potential of all our policies, budget decisions and service provision.

The 1998 Crime and Disorder Act provides local authorities, and a number of key statutory partners (including the police) with a legal framework to reduce crime and disorder. Section 17 of the Act requires local authorities, police authorities and other agencies to consider crime and disorder reduction and community safety when carrying out all service delivery and duties.

Section 17 (Crime and Disorder Act)

'Without prejudice to any other obligation imposed upon it, it shall be the duty of each authority to exercise the various functions with due regard to the likely effect of the exercise of those functions on, and the need to do all that it reasonably can to prevent crime and disorder in its area.'

We are also working closely with the Community Safety Partnership to contribute to partnership work relating to crime and community safety.
